About Firehawk Aerospace

Firehawk Aerospace is pioneering the development of additively manufactured rocket propulsion systems, combining advanced manufacturing techniques with innovative engineering to deliver safer, more reliable, and cost-effective solutions for space exploration and defense. We are seeking a talented Manufacturing Engineer to join our team and help shape the future of rocket motor manufacturing.

Job Summary

As a Manufacturing Engineer at Firehawk Aerospace, you will play a critical role in developing, optimizing, and supporting manufacturing processes for our rocket motor systems. You will work closely with design, quality, and production teams to ensure efficient, high-quality, and scalable manufacturing operations. This position requires a hands-on approach to problem-solving, a strong understanding of manufacturing principles, and a commitment to continuous improvement.

Key Responsibilities

  • Develop, implement, and optimize integration and manufacturing processes for the production of rocket motor systems, ensuring efficiency, quality, and safety.

  • Collaborate with design engineering teams to ensure manufacturability of integration of components and assemblies, providing Design for Manufacturing and Assembly (DFMA) feedback during the development phase.

  • Create and maintain detailed work instructions, process documentation, and manufacturing plans to support production and hardware integration activities.

  • Identify and implement process improvements to enhance overall production efficiency.

  • Establish and equip a facility to perform Lot Acceptance Testing (LAT) and support ongoing LAT activities, ensuring compliance with quality and performance standards.

  • Support the design, procurement, and implementation of manufacturing tools, fixtures, and equipment to meet production requirements.

  • Lead root cause analysis and corrective action efforts for production issues.

  • Develop and execute validation and qualification plans for new processes, equipment, and materials.

  • Collaborate with quality engineering to ensure compliance with industry standards, customer requirements, and internal quality systems.

  • Support the implementation of automation and advanced manufacturing technologies, into manufacturing processes.

  • Assist in generation of key performance indicators (KPIs) such as cycle time, scrap rates, and downtime, and develop strategies to improve performance.

  • Support proposal development as required.

  • Ensure compliance with safety, environmental, and regulatory requirements in the manufacturing environment.
